Saving templates in Movie Studio 12

Ashjuk wrote on 11/13/2015, 7:25 AM
I can't seem to save a rendering template.
I have modified an existing template to uprate the audio quality and have entered a new name for it.
I then click on the disc icon to save it with the new name and it appears in the list with a (*) after the name. I can use the new template to render a project so it appears to work OK.
If I close the program the next time I go to render a project there is no sign of the modified template I saved last time.
I have looked in the Project Templates folder and there is no sign of my new template so it's obviously not getting saved.
Any ideas?

Another thought.....have you checked the "More filter options" in Render As, your custom template may just be hiding, depending on the options you have selected in the More filter options.

I did scroll all through the templates and could not see it, but I will have another good look and make sure the "More filter options" are not hiding it.

I had another search of my PC and I did come across the saved template in \AppData\Roaming\Sony\Render Templates\avc-sony - but I've no idea why it appears not to be visible in the application.
